Exegesis

The idiom ve-natatti panai {וְנָתַתִּי פָנַי | wə-nāṭâttî panāy} ‘and I will set My face’ expresses divine opposition against the blood-consuming nefesh {נֶפֶשׁ | nep̄eš} ‘life essence.’

In contextLeviticus 17:10

Should any man of the house of Israel or any sojourner residing among them eat blood, I will set My face against the nefesh consuming blood and will cut that person off from among his people.
